Credit Suisse has found a new home for underworked leveraged finance bankers.
The team is being merged with its investment grade financing arm to create a new global credit unit headed by Tim O'Hara , former co-head of leveraged finance. His fellow former co-head Jim Amine was promoted to co-head of investment banking. Mr O'Hara is the last of the three former co-heads of leveraged finance to be reinvented, after Don Pollard 's move to alternative investments.
